What Is Jojoba Oil?

Jojoba oil is an oil extracted from the seed of the Jojoba plant, the botanical name of which is Simmondsia chinensis. In its pure form, jojoba oil is golden in colour with a faint nutty odour, while processed jojoba oil is typically clear and odourless. Long before it was used as an ingredient in many of the cosmetic products on the market today, Native Americans used jojoba oil to treat and heal wounds and it’s these same healing properties that can help treat dry and damaged hair and scalp.

 What Are the Benefits of Using Jojoba Oil?

Unlike other oils, jojoba oil most closely resembles the molecular structure of the sebum present in our own skin. Because of this distinct attribute, jojoba oil is perfect for hair and skin and can provide a number of amazing benefits that other oils simply cannot.

  • It’s Antibacterial

If you suffer from scalp conditions like dandruff or seborrheic dermatitis, jojoba oil can help to not only hydrate your dry scalp but keep it free of harmful bacteria that can worsen the issue.

  •  It’s Moisturizing and Hydrating

Typical shampoos contain ingredients such as SLS (sodium lauryl sulfate) that work create the foaming effect we’re all used to. Unfortunately, this chemical can also dry out the scalp. Jojoba oil, on the other hand, can help treat dryness from the continual use of standard shampoos and provide extra hydration when necessary.

  •    It’s An Emollient

After washing, heating, and styling, it’s no wonder hair takes such a beating. Jojoba oil, however, can actually fill in the cracks of the hair cuticle and effectively repair damage caused by over-styling.

  •    It’s Full of Vitamins and Minerals

Because jojoba oil is natural, it contains many important vitamins and naturally occurring minerals, not the least of which is Vitamin E. Vitamin E is renowned for its healing properties for the skin which work well to promote healthy scalp and hair, too.

How Do You Use Jojoba Oil In Your Hair?

Because of its versatility, jojoba oil can be used in a number of ways to experience its many benefits.

  •    Add It to Shampoo

Harsh ingredients and chemicals can strip your hair of its naturally present sebum, but by adding a few drops of jojoba oil to your bottle, you can begin to counteract the damaging effects.

  •    As a Hair Mask

Many oils are used to hydrate dry and lifeless hair and by combining a few of your favorites, you can get all sorts of amazing benefits. Whether you use olive oil, argan oil or any other, add jojoba oil to the list add you’ll experience its powerful healing and hydrating properties.

  •    As a Leave In Conditioner

If you want to use straight jojoba oil on your scalp and hair, making a leave-in conditioner is one of the best ways to do so. Simply mix a small amount of jojoba oil with water in a spray bottle and apply to your clean hair.
